Python-面向过程与面向对象
面向过程:
以程序执行过程为设计流程的编程思想,自顶向下顺序执行,其程序结构是按照功能分为若干个基本模块(一台设备以工位划分),
各模块之间在功能上互相独立,关系简单;而各个模块内部可根据实际情况选择顺序、选择、循环基本结构,每个模块每个步骤用分别
的函数来实现。通过这种思路,可以把复杂问题简单化,一个一个功能单独解决。
面向对象:
以事物为中心的编程思想,对象包含两个含义:数据和动作。另外方法是指对象能够进行的操作,也叫做函数。继承是指从顶层继
承一些方法和变量。类是指具有相同特性和行为的对象。封装是指把数据和代码捆绑在一起。